mirror of
https://github.com/simstudioai/sim.git
synced 2026-02-05 04:05:14 -05:00
* feat(i18n): update translations * fixed chinese docs --------- Co-authored-by: waleedlatif1 <waleedlatif1@users.noreply.github.com>
234 lines
9.6 KiB
Plaintext
234 lines
9.6 KiB
Plaintext
---
|
|
title: Fireflies
|
|
description: Interactúa con transcripciones y grabaciones de reuniones de Fireflies.ai
|
|
---
|
|
|
|
import { BlockInfoCard } from "@/components/ui/block-info-card"
|
|
|
|
<BlockInfoCard
|
|
type="fireflies"
|
|
color="#100730"
|
|
/>
|
|
|
|
{/* MANUAL-CONTENT-START:intro */}
|
|
[Fireflies.ai](https://fireflies.ai/) es una plataforma de transcripción e inteligencia de reuniones que se integra con Sim, permitiendo que tus agentes trabajen directamente con grabaciones de reuniones, transcripciones e información mediante automatizaciones sin código.
|
|
|
|
La integración de Fireflies en Sim proporciona herramientas para:
|
|
|
|
- **Listar transcripciones de reuniones:** Obtén múltiples reuniones y su información resumida para tu equipo o cuenta.
|
|
- **Recuperar detalles completos de transcripciones:** Accede a transcripciones detalladas, incluyendo resúmenes, elementos de acción, temas y análisis de participantes para cualquier reunión.
|
|
- **Subir audio o vídeo:** Sube archivos de audio/vídeo o proporciona URLs para transcripción—opcionalmente establece idioma, título, asistentes y recibe notas de reunión automatizadas.
|
|
- **Buscar transcripciones:** Encuentra reuniones por palabra clave, participante, anfitrión o periodo de tiempo para localizar rápidamente discusiones relevantes.
|
|
- **Eliminar transcripciones:** Elimina transcripciones de reuniones específicas de tu espacio de trabajo de Fireflies.
|
|
- **Crear fragmentos destacados (Bites):** Extrae y resalta momentos clave de las transcripciones como clips de audio o vídeo.
|
|
- **Activar flujos de trabajo al completar la transcripción:** Activa flujos de trabajo de Sim automáticamente cuando finaliza una transcripción de reunión de Fireflies usando el webhook trigger proporcionado—habilitando automatizaciones en tiempo real y notificaciones basadas en nuevos datos de reuniones.
|
|
|
|
Al combinar estas capacidades, puedes optimizar acciones posteriores a las reuniones, extraer información estructurada, automatizar notificaciones, gestionar grabaciones y orquestar flujos de trabajo personalizados en torno a las llamadas de tu organización—todo de forma segura usando tu clave API y credenciales de Fireflies.
|
|
{/* MANUAL-CONTENT-END */}
|
|
|
|
## Instrucciones de uso
|
|
|
|
Integra Fireflies.ai en el flujo de trabajo. Gestiona transcripciones de reuniones, añade bot a reuniones en vivo, crea fragmentos destacados y más. También puede activar flujos de trabajo cuando se completan las transcripciones.
|
|
|
|
## Herramientas
|
|
|
|
### `fireflies_list_transcripts`
|
|
|
|
Lista las transcripciones de reuniones de Fireflies.ai con filtrado opcional
|
|
|
|
#### Entrada
|
|
|
|
| Parámetro | Tipo | Requerido | Descripción |
|
|
| --------- | ---- | -------- | ----------- |
|
|
| `apiKey` | string | Sí | Clave API de Fireflies |
|
|
| `keyword` | string | No | Palabra clave de búsqueda en el título de la reunión o transcripción |
|
|
| `fromDate` | string | No | Filtra transcripciones desde esta fecha \(formato ISO 8601\) |
|
|
| `toDate` | string | No | Filtra transcripciones hasta esta fecha \(formato ISO 8601\) |
|
|
| `hostEmail` | string | No | Filtra por correo electrónico del anfitrión de la reunión |
|
|
| `participants` | string | No | Filtra por correos electrónicos de participantes \(separados por comas\) |
|
|
| `limit` | number | No | Número máximo de transcripciones a devolver \(máx. 50\) |
|
|
| `skip` | number | No | Número de transcripciones a omitir para paginación |
|
|
|
|
#### Salida
|
|
|
|
| Parámetro | Tipo | Descripción |
|
|
| --------- | ---- | ----------- |
|
|
| `transcripts` | array | Lista de transcripciones |
|
|
| `count` | number | Número de transcripciones devueltas |
|
|
|
|
### `fireflies_get_transcript`
|
|
|
|
Obtiene una única transcripción con detalles completos, incluyendo resumen, elementos de acción y análisis
|
|
|
|
#### Entrada
|
|
|
|
| Parámetro | Tipo | Requerido | Descripción |
|
|
| --------- | ---- | -------- | ----------- |
|
|
| `apiKey` | string | Sí | Clave API de Fireflies |
|
|
| `transcriptId` | string | Sí | El ID de transcripción a recuperar |
|
|
|
|
#### Salida
|
|
|
|
| Parámetro | Tipo | Descripción |
|
|
| --------- | ---- | ----------- |
|
|
| `transcript` | object | La transcripción con detalles completos |
|
|
|
|
### `fireflies_get_user`
|
|
|
|
Obtener información del usuario de Fireflies.ai. Devuelve el usuario actual si no se especifica ningún ID.
|
|
|
|
#### Entrada
|
|
|
|
| Parámetro | Tipo | Requerido | Descripción |
|
|
| --------- | ---- | -------- | ----------- |
|
|
| `apiKey` | string | Sí | Clave API de Fireflies |
|
|
| `userId` | string | No | ID de usuario a recuperar \(opcional, por defecto el propietario de la clave API\) |
|
|
|
|
#### Salida
|
|
|
|
| Parámetro | Tipo | Descripción |
|
|
| --------- | ---- | ----------- |
|
|
| `user` | object | Información del usuario |
|
|
|
|
### `fireflies_list_users`
|
|
|
|
Listar todos los usuarios dentro de tu equipo de Fireflies.ai
|
|
|
|
#### Entrada
|
|
|
|
| Parámetro | Tipo | Requerido | Descripción |
|
|
| --------- | ---- | -------- | ----------- |
|
|
| `apiKey` | string | Sí | Clave API de Fireflies |
|
|
|
|
#### Salida
|
|
|
|
| Parámetro | Tipo | Descripción |
|
|
| --------- | ---- | ----------- |
|
|
| `users` | array | Lista de usuarios del equipo |
|
|
|
|
### `fireflies_upload_audio`
|
|
|
|
Subir una URL de archivo de audio a Fireflies.ai para transcripción
|
|
|
|
#### Entrada
|
|
|
|
| Parámetro | Tipo | Requerido | Descripción |
|
|
| --------- | ---- | -------- | ----------- |
|
|
| `apiKey` | string | Sí | Clave API de Fireflies |
|
|
| `audioFile` | file | No | Archivo de audio/vídeo a subir para transcripción |
|
|
| `audioUrl` | string | No | URL HTTPS pública del archivo de audio/vídeo \(MP3, MP4, WAV, M4A, OGG\) |
|
|
| `title` | string | No | Título para la reunión/transcripción |
|
|
| `webhook` | string | No | URL de webhook para notificar cuando la transcripción esté completa |
|
|
| `language` | string | No | Código de idioma para la transcripción \(por ejemplo, "es" para español, "de" para alemán\) |
|
|
| `attendees` | string | No | Asistentes en formato JSON: \[\{"displayName": "Nombre", "email": "email@example.com"\}\] |
|
|
| `clientReferenceId` | string | No | ID de referencia personalizado para seguimiento |
|
|
|
|
#### Salida
|
|
|
|
| Parámetro | Tipo | Descripción |
|
|
| --------- | ---- | ----------- |
|
|
| `success` | boolean | Si la carga fue exitosa |
|
|
| `title` | string | Título de la reunión cargada |
|
|
| `message` | string | Mensaje de estado de Fireflies |
|
|
|
|
### `fireflies_delete_transcript`
|
|
|
|
Eliminar una transcripción de Fireflies.ai
|
|
|
|
#### Entrada
|
|
|
|
| Parámetro | Tipo | Requerido | Descripción |
|
|
| --------- | ---- | -------- | ----------- |
|
|
| `apiKey` | string | Sí | Clave API de Fireflies |
|
|
| `transcriptId` | string | Sí | El ID de la transcripción a eliminar |
|
|
|
|
#### Salida
|
|
|
|
| Parámetro | Tipo | Descripción |
|
|
| --------- | ---- | ----------- |
|
|
| `success` | boolean | Si la transcripción fue eliminada exitosamente |
|
|
|
|
### `fireflies_add_to_live_meeting`
|
|
|
|
Agregar el bot de Fireflies.ai a una reunión en curso para grabar y transcribir
|
|
|
|
#### Entrada
|
|
|
|
| Parámetro | Tipo | Requerido | Descripción |
|
|
| --------- | ---- | -------- | ----------- |
|
|
| `apiKey` | string | Sí | Clave API de Fireflies |
|
|
| `meetingLink` | string | Sí | URL de reunión válida \(Zoom, Google Meet, Microsoft Teams, etc.\) |
|
|
| `title` | string | No | Título para la reunión \(máximo 256 caracteres\) |
|
|
| `meetingPassword` | string | No | Contraseña para la reunión si es necesaria \(máximo 32 caracteres\) |
|
|
| `duration` | number | No | Duración de la reunión en minutos \(15-120, predeterminado: 60\) |
|
|
| `language` | string | No | Código de idioma para la transcripción \(p. ej., "en", "es", "de"\) |
|
|
|
|
#### Salida
|
|
|
|
| Parámetro | Tipo | Descripción |
|
|
| --------- | ---- | ----------- |
|
|
| `success` | boolean | Si el bot se agregó exitosamente a la reunión |
|
|
|
|
### `fireflies_create_bite`
|
|
|
|
Crear un fragmento destacado desde un rango de tiempo específico en una transcripción
|
|
|
|
#### Entrada
|
|
|
|
| Parámetro | Tipo | Requerido | Descripción |
|
|
| --------- | ---- | -------- | ----------- |
|
|
| `apiKey` | string | Sí | Clave API de Fireflies |
|
|
| `transcriptId` | string | Sí | ID de la transcripción desde la cual crear el fragmento |
|
|
| `startTime` | number | Sí | Tiempo de inicio del fragmento en segundos |
|
|
| `endTime` | number | Sí | Tiempo de finalización del fragmento en segundos |
|
|
| `name` | string | No | Nombre para el fragmento \(máximo 256 caracteres\) |
|
|
| `mediaType` | string | No | Tipo de medio: "video" o "audio" |
|
|
| `summary` | string | No | Resumen para el fragmento \(máximo 500 caracteres\) |
|
|
|
|
#### Salida
|
|
|
|
| Parámetro | Tipo | Descripción |
|
|
| --------- | ---- | ----------- |
|
|
| `bite` | object | Detalles del fragmento creado |
|
|
|
|
### `fireflies_list_bites`
|
|
|
|
Listar fragmentos destacados de Fireflies.ai
|
|
|
|
#### Entrada
|
|
|
|
| Parámetro | Tipo | Requerido | Descripción |
|
|
| --------- | ---- | -------- | ----------- |
|
|
| `apiKey` | string | Sí | Clave API de Fireflies |
|
|
| `transcriptId` | string | No | Filtrar fragmentos para una transcripción específica |
|
|
| `mine` | boolean | No | Devolver solo fragmentos propiedad del titular de la clave API \(predeterminado: true\) |
|
|
| `limit` | number | No | Número máximo de fragmentos a devolver \(máximo 50\) |
|
|
| `skip` | number | No | Número de fragmentos a omitir para paginación |
|
|
|
|
#### Salida
|
|
|
|
| Parámetro | Tipo | Descripción |
|
|
| --------- | ---- | ----------- |
|
|
| `bites` | array | Lista de fragmentos/clips de audio |
|
|
|
|
### `fireflies_list_contacts`
|
|
|
|
Lista todos los contactos de tus reuniones de Fireflies.ai
|
|
|
|
#### Entrada
|
|
|
|
| Parámetro | Tipo | Requerido | Descripción |
|
|
| --------- | ---- | -------- | ----------- |
|
|
| `apiKey` | string | Sí | Clave API de Fireflies |
|
|
|
|
#### Salida
|
|
|
|
| Parámetro | Tipo | Descripción |
|
|
| --------- | ---- | ----------- |
|
|
| `contacts` | array | Lista de contactos de las reuniones |
|
|
|
|
## Notas
|
|
|
|
- Categoría: `tools`
|
|
- Tipo: `fireflies`
|